Entry Requirements for NVQ Level 3 Children's Health and Social Care

If you are interested in pursuing an NVQ Level 3 in Children's Health and Social Care, there are certain entry requirements that you must meet. These requirements are designed to ensure that you have the necessary skills and knowledge to successfully complete the course and work effectively in the field of children's health and social care.

Requirement Description
Age You must be at least 16 years old to enroll in an NVQ Level 3 course.
Education You should have a good understanding of English and Math, typically at a Level 2 or equivalent.
Experience Some courses may require you to have relevant work experience in the field of children's health and social care.
Clearance You may need to undergo a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check to ensure your suitability to work with children.

It is important to check with the specific training provider offering the NVQ Level 3 Children's Health and Social Care course for their exact entry requirements, as these may vary slightly depending on the institution.
